Engineering kidney developmental trajectory using culture boundary conditions

2024-12-16

Abstract excerpt

Kidney explant cultures are traditionally carried out at air-liquid interfaces, which disrupts 3D tissue structure and limits interpretation of developmental data. To overcome this limitation, we developed a 3D culture technique using hydrogel embedding to capture morphogenesis in real time.
